Spatial cognition: gathering strategies used by preschool children.

E H Cornell, C D Heth.   

Abstract

How preschool children retrieve hidden objects was examined in two cross-sectional studies. The first was a simple task in which 1- and 3-year-olds saw two treats hidden in their living room. The newly walking infants generally sought the closer treat first, providing evidence for a least-distance spatial strategy. However, this strategy was affected by a tendency to approach the hiding place most recently baited. Three-year-old children used a least-distance strategy regardless of the order of hidings. In Experiment 2, 3- and 5-year-olds saw 12 puzzle pieces hidden in various containers equally spaced within a naturally furnished children's laboratory. Factors in addition to age were the distinctiveness of the containers and a requirement to return to the center of the array after each retrieval. Overall, children of both age groups were quite successful at this task, retrieving 11 of the pieces. However, 3-year-olds were less efficient, retrieving fewer pieces and requiring more searches. Detailed analyses of errors and patterns of choices indicated differential processes in achieving their performance. Three-year-old children showed the use of memories for events, discrimination of classes of hiding places, and efficient spatial biases. Five-year-old children were more likely to exhibit these processes concurrently.
